Aesthetic Appeal and Design Versatility

Steel and glass doors transcend mere functionality, becoming striking architectural features within a space. Their sleek lines and minimalist profiles complement a wide range of interior design styles, from ultra-modern lofts to revitalized traditional homes. The transparency of glass allows for visual continuity between rooms, creating a sense of spaciousness and openness. Furthermore, the steel frames can be customized with various finishes, powder coatings, and hardware options to perfectly match your aesthetic vision.

  • Clean, modern aesthetic
  • Customizable frame finishes
  • Increased visual connectivity between rooms
  • Complements diverse interior styles

Enhanced Natural Light and Energy Efficiency

One of the most significant benefits of steel and glass doors is their ability to maximize natural light penetration. This not only brightens interior spaces but also reduces the need for artificial lighting, leading to significant energy savings. The use of insulated glass units (IGUs) further enhances energy efficiency by minimizing heat transfer during both summer and winter months. This contributes to a more comfortable and sustainable living environment.

Insulated Glass Options

Different types of insulated glass are available to cater to specific energy efficiency requirements:

  • Low-E Glass: Reduces heat gain and loss.
  • Tinted Glass: Minimizes glare and solar heat.
  • Laminated Glass: Provides enhanced security and sound insulation.

Durability, Security, and Low Maintenance

Steel is renowned for its exceptional strength and durability, making steel-framed doors a robust security barrier. Unlike wood, steel is resistant to warping, rotting, and insect infestation, ensuring long-lasting performance. The combination of steel and tempered glass creates a virtually impenetrable barrier against intruders. Furthermore, steel and glass doors require minimal maintenance, simply needing occasional cleaning to maintain their pristine appearance.
